Frequently Asked Questions

What type of batteries does the YR06381 use? The device is powered by two AA batteries (1.5V x2).

Can this meter conduct automatic calibration? Yes, it supports automatic calibration for both air saturated by water and water saturated by air.

Technical Specifications

Model YR06381
pH
Measuring range (-2.00~19.99)pH
Resolution 0.1/0.01 pH
Accuracy Meter:±0.01pH; Overall: ±0.02pH
Input impendance ≥1×1012 Ω
Stability ±0.01 pH/3h
Temp. compensation (0~100)ºC (Auto/manual)
mV
Measuring range ±1999.9mV
Resolution 1mV
Accuracy ±0.1% FS
DO
Measuring range (0 ~ 20.00) mg/L(ppm), (0 ~ 200.0)%
Resolution 0.1/0.01 mg/L(ppm), 1/0.1 %
Accuracy Electrode: ±0.10 mg/L, Instrument: ±0.40 mg/L
Response time ≤30s (25ºC, 90%response)
Residual current ≤0.1 mg/L
Temp. compensation (0 ~ 45)ºC (auto)
Salinity compensation (0 ~ 45) ppt (auto)
Pressure compensation (66 ~ 200) kPa (manual)
Auto calibration Air saturated by water, water saturated by air
Electrode type Polarographic
Temp.
Measuring range (0 ~ 100)ºC
Resolution 0.1ºC
Accuracy 5 ~ 60ºC:±0.4ºC Others: ±0.8ºC
Other
Data storage 200 sets
Power Two AA batteries (1.5V x2)
Ambient Temp. 5 ~ 35 ºC
Ambient humidity ≤85%
IP grade IP57 Dustproof and waterproof
Dimensions/N.W. (65×120×31)mm/180g
Shipping size/G.W. (460×300×55)mm/1Kg
